The Island steamer Navna is due lo arrive at Auckland from Suva and the other Western Pacific ports at I! a.m. on Slouday with passengers and cargo. The vessel will tierth at the Queen's wharf, and aft( r discharging her cargo sho will lay tip. ller place In the trade will be taken by the Tofua, which is announced to leave Auckland next Saturday. The Tofua will come alongside the Central wharf on Monday.

I KAIKORAI IN PORT. j Tlii' Union Company's steamer Kaikoral arm.-d :it Auckland this morning from N.'v,...i5i1,.. via Sydney. Suva and Tonga Fiinl his'lhi'd Mt the Kings wharf. Tin- vt-.-cl brought a cargo of coal from NcHi-tistle, and 2100 bunches of I •iniiaiiu* .'<•,. m Tonga. She left NewI ,'iiniH' "ii Fi-hruary 2S, and Sydney on : Miir-h I, arriving at Suva on March 1). The i.liiyf., .iii.l proceeded to Lauluka on March ! ::.. which purl she left on llio following i ...■■> lov Nukualofa. The weather at this !.: 1 mmo unpleasant, and on March JO aud 1T iln- Kaikorai was unable to make Nnkiiyl ifii uniug to a strong nvrtherij | -.<!. . Tin , following <lay she arrived In port ami lilt on .March 10 for Auckland.
